Abstract

The invention discloses a kind of clothes hanger based on data analysis, the clothes hanger based on data analysis includes furred ceiling, two parallelogram articulated telescopic mechanisms, drying devices, the one side of the furred ceiling is fixed on roof, the one end of edge respectively with described two parallelogram articulated telescopic mechanisms on two widths of the another side of the furred ceiling is connected, the other end of described two parallelogram articulated telescopic mechanisms connects two cross bars in the drying device respectively, is connected between described two cross bars using the identical connecting rod of multiple length;Multiple hooks are fixedly installed in the bottom face of the cross bar, spacing is equal between the multiple hook, and gravity sensor, hook communicator are set on each hook;The bottom face of the cross bar also passes through a rope JA(junction ambient) monitoring device.Clothes hanger disclosed by the invention based on data analysis can estimate the time of clothes drying so that user being capable of reasonable arrangement activity.

Technical field
The present invention relates to clothes hanger field, in particular to a kind of clothes hanger based on data analysis.
Background technology
With accelerating for people's rhythm of life, people increasingly have no time to do some trival matters, and ratio is swept the floor, therefore is emerged in large numbers The smart machine largely used in home scenarios shares the work of people.Traditional clothes hanger needs user's clothes support pole Clothes is put into eminence, physical demands is not only significantly increased but also also have lost the substantial amounts of time at the same time.
Therefore, Intellective airer has existed in the prior art, has been that user's use touches the button or manually by the side of remote controler Formula realizes the electronic upper and lower of clothes hanger.However, this mode is not smart home device truly, still Need artificial to carry out operation intervention with hand, it is also necessary to people rise in clothes hanger, decline spent on this it is extra when Between and energy, that is, touch the button, the time by remote controler, not as advanced sweeping robot be not required user effort when Between and energy just go to sweep the floor, swept and return original position charging, do not realize the real intelligence on clothes hanger.And And user is known when clothing can be done, so that user needs to put down clothes hanger touches clothing using artificial hand The mode of thing, which judges to do, not to be done, if not having the dry liter that also needs to go back.

Embodiment
In order to enable the objects, technical solutions and advantages of the present invention are more clearly understood, below in conjunction with attached drawing and its implementation Example, the present invention will be described in further detail;It should be appreciated that specific embodiment described herein is only used for explaining this hair It is bright, it is not intended to limit the present invention.To those skilled in the art, after access is described in detail below, the present embodiment Other systems, method and/or feature will become obvious.It is intended to all such additional systems, method, feature and advantage It is included in this specification, is included within the scope of the invention, and is protected by the appended claims.In detailed below Describe the other feature of the disclosed embodiments, and these characteristic roots according to it is described in detail below will be aobvious and easy See.
Embodiment one.
Incorporated by reference to attached drawing 1.
A kind of clothes hanger based on data analysis, it is characterised in that the clothes hanger based on data analysis include furred ceiling, Two parallelogram articulated telescopic mechanisms, drying devices, the one side of the furred ceiling are fixed on roof, the another side of the furred ceiling Two widths on one end respectively with described two parallelogram articulated telescopic mechanisms of edge be connected, described two The other end of a parallelogram articulated telescopic mechanism connects two cross bars in the drying device, described two cross bars respectively Between using multiple length it is identical connecting rod connection;Multiple hooks are fixedly installed in the bottom face of the cross bar, it is the multiple Spacing is equal between hook, and gravity sensor, hook communicator are set on each hook;The bottom face of the cross bar is also logical Cross a rope JA(junction ambient) monitoring device;
The furred ceiling includes communicator, the controller being provided at its inner portion;
The weight of the carried object of the gravity sensor detection hook, the communicator of linking up with is by the weight The communicator is transferred to, the weight is transferred to the controller by the communicator, and the controller judges numerical value most Big weight is simultaneously stored as G;
Embody the size of clothing with weight, weight it is big relative to small more difficult dry of weight, therefore it is big to choose weight Benchmark the most considers;
The environment monitoring device includes temperature sensor, humidity sensor, illumination detector, air speed measuring apparatus, communication Element, the temperature sensor, humidity sensor, illumination detector can be measured directly around the environment monitoring device respectively Temperature, humidity and the intensity of illumination of environment, the frequency and amplitude that the air speed measuring apparatus is swung according to the environment monitoring device The wind speed of the environment monitoring device surrounding environment is calculated, the communication device is strong by the temperature, humidity, illumination Degree, wind speed radio to the communicator, and the temperature, humidity, intensity of illumination, wind speed are transferred to described by the communicator Controller, the controller are calculated based on the temperature T, humidity H, intensity of illumination S, wind speed W, G and based on estimation model Drying time;
It is described to estimate that model isWherein, n1-n5 is index coefficient, and the A is constant;
The index coefficient and the constant are obtained by the regression analysis based on big data;
Sound detection device, infrared detector are installed on the another side of the furred ceiling, the furred ceiling further includes setting Voice recognition device, two motor, storage batteries inside it;The sound detection device, which is used to detecting, described is based on data The sound occurred around the clothes hanger of analysis;The voice recognition device is connected with the sound detection device, for identifying State whether the sound that sound detection device detects is user instruction;Described two motor are respectively with described two parallel four Bian Xing articulated telescopics mechanism connects one to one, and the motor is used to drive the parallelogram articulated telescopic mechanism to realize Telescopic;The communicator is additionally operable to be connected with the communicator of washing machine, external device communication;The infrared detector is used for It whether there is human body in detection predeterminable area;The controller is additionally operable to receive the result of detection of the infrared detector, described The communication information of the recognition result of voice recognition device, the communicator, and then output control information gives the motor;The storage Battery is the sound detection device, infrared detector, voice recognition device, motor, communicator, controller connection and then is The sound detection device, infrared detector, voice recognition device, motor, communicator, controller provide electric power;
When washing machine washes clothing, the communicator of washing machine can send notification to the communicator, and the communicator will The notification transmission gives the controller, the controller controlled when the notice is not received by the storage battery with The sound detection device, infrared detector, voice recognition device, the electrically connected circuit of motor disconnect, so that institute State storage battery to stop as the sound detection device, infrared detector, voice recognition device, powering electric motors so that institute State sound detection device, infrared detector, voice recognition device, motor to be in entirely without electric state, and then save electric power; The storage battery and the sound detection device, infrared detector, sound are controlled when the controller receives the notice The electrically connected circuit connection of identification device, motor, so that the storage battery can be the sound detection device, red External detector, voice recognition device, powering electric motors so that the sound detection device, infrared detector, voice recognition Device, motor are in standby state;
The clothing only cleaned just needs to dry, i.e., the described clothes hanger based on data analysis is only needed in washing machine work Realization is just needed to extend downwardly after finishing so as to facilitate user's suspended garment, this set realizes real meaning by Internet of Things On smart home;And off-position is usually in, and then reduce electric energy usage amount;
When sound occurs in surrounding, the sound detection device is transferred to working status from holding state and detects around described The sound of appearance, the sound detection device are compared the volume for the sound that the surrounding occurs with preset sound detection range Compared with when the volume for the sound that the surrounding occurs is more than the preset sound examination scope lower limit and is examined less than the preset sound When surveying range limit, the form that the sound that the surrounding occurs is converted into sound wave by the sound detection device is transferred to the sound Sound identification device, otherwise the sound detection device reenter holding state;
The scope for the volume spoken according to normal person can exclude the number voice produced due to environmental disturbances, so that in advance Unnecessary content is first excluded, system energy consumption can also be reduced at the same time by improving recognition efficiency;
The voice recognition device is when receiving from the sound wave that the sound detection device transmits from standby State is transferred to working status, and whether the frequency for judging the sound according to the sound wave first is in the scope of 200-800Hz It is interior, holding state is reentered if not the then voice recognition device, if it is the voice recognition device is further Judge to prestore in the sound wave and database according to any one in multiple reference waveforms caused by the user instruction Similarity, when the similarity is more than a default value, the voice recognition device judges that the sound refers to for the user Order, and recognition result is transferred to the controller, otherwise the voice recognition device reenters holding state;
Since the process of clothes hanger extension needs the time, in order to avoid user waits the both hands for liberating user at the same time to reach true Positive smart home, extends downwardly operation so that user can move towards washing machine using voice control come realize clothes hanger During i.e. send instruction so that clothes hanger automatically realize it is downward, user taking-up clothes after without waiting may be used Directly clothes is placed on hook;Progressive detection mode can further reduce system energy consumption;
When the controller receives the recognition result, the controller sends a first control signal to described Motor, and enabling signal is sent at the same time to the infrared detector;
The motor is transferred to working status from holding state when receiving the first control signal and realizes first Operating on a direction, the motor run the scheduled time so that originally described flat in compressive state with desired speed Row quadrangle articulated telescopic mechanism gradually stretches so that the multiple hook is moved to target by initial position in the vertical direction Position;
When the hook is moved on target location, user can be by clothes hanger on hook;
The infrared detector is visited in real time after being transferred to working status from holding state when receiving the enabling signal Survey whether there is human body, and when the infrared detector is able to detect that human body, the infrared detector gives the controller always Working signal is sent, when the infrared detector no longer detects human body, the infrared detector does not retransmit working signal, The controller detects the working signal and interrupts the time undergone afterwards, when the time reaching default value, the control Device processed sends a second control signal to the motor;
The motor is realized when receiving the second control signal at second opposite with first direction Operating on direction, the motor run the scheduled time so that being in extended state originally with the desired speed The parallelogram articulated telescopic mechanism gradually reduces so that the multiple hook is by the target location in the vertical direction It is moved to the initial position;
After user registers clothes, clothes hanger can detect whether people leaves and do not return for a long time automatically, that is, table Bright clothes has been hung up properly, so that the realization fully automated, intelligent in the case where being not required user to provide any instruction rises, from And realize the drying of clothes;
The controller controls the environment monitoring device to realize the monitoring to environment afterwards, so calculate estimate when Between;Time showing can also be come out so that user is capable of the activity of reasonable arrangement oneself;
The communicator is received from external equipment transmission according to multiple reference waveforms caused by the user instruction, and The controller will be transferred to according to multiple reference waveforms caused by the user instruction described in reception, the controller will It is described to be stored according to multiple reference waveforms caused by the user instruction in the database of its own;
The user instruction can arbitrarily be set by user;The multiple reference waveform include multiple and different people according to The sound wave that family instructs and formed.This set causes the control of clothes hanger to rely only on the voice of a people in family, also It can identify other people voice, so that everyone can realize the control to clothes hanger in family, and then improve User experience.
